Co-doped RuO2 Decorated Carbon Hollow Spheres as Efficient Electrocatalysts for Rechargeable Zinc-Air Batteries
Yi Liang1, Hanbin Wang1, Xianxian Wang1
1School of Integrated Circuits, Hubei University, Wuhan, China.
Abstract:
A pyrolysis method was employed to deposit Co doped RuO2 nanoparticles on nitrogen-doped hollow carbon spheres (NHCS). Attributed to the excellent bifunctional electrocatalytic properties of Co-RuO2@NHCS, the zinc-air battery yielded an open circuit voltage of 1.51 V and the power density reached 180 mW/m2. After 800 galvanostatic charge-discharge cycles, the charge-discharge voltage gap of the battery only decayed by 5.7%, demonstrating superior cycling stability.
